Fearing the Lord, is not the kind of thing of being scared or afraid - but of respect and reverence. Knowing that God will discipline and rebuke you if break His commands but also knowing if you break them you are not condemned..

This leads to respect and reverence.. respect for His boundaries, reverence for His saving power and grace
